Overview

Postcode DA1 4NP is located in a major urban area, within the Crayford ward of Bexley in the London region, and forms part of the Crayford area. It has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 35.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Crayford is £73,561 per year. The nearest station is Crayford located about 0.7 miles away. There are 7 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, closest medium park is Jolly Farmers Open Space.

Frequently asked questions about DA1 4NP

Is DA1 4NP (Crayford) safe?

The area around DA1 4NP records about 36 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, which is a very low crime rate for England — it scores 2 out of 10 on the Area360 crime scale, where 10 is the highest crime level. Across London as a whole the rate is about 130 per 1,000. The most common offences locally are violence and sexual offences, criminal damage and arson and anti-social behaviour.

What is the average house price near DA1 4NP?

The median sale price around DA1 4NP in Crayford is £375,000 (about £4,818 per square metre) based on 156 registered sales — HM Land Registry data.

What schools are near DA1 4NP?

There are 11 schools close to DA1 4NP, including Haberdashers' Crayford Academy (Good), Haberdashers' Crayford Primary and St Paulinus Church of England Primary School (Good). Ratings are from the latest Ofsted inspections.

What is the nearest station to DA1 4NP?

The closest station to DA1 4NP is Crayford in TfL zone 6, about 1,116 m away, serving the Southeastern line.

How deprived is the area around DA1 4NP?

DA1 4NP scores 4 out of 10 on the deprivation scale, where 10 is the most deprived. Its neighbourhood ranks 17,727 of 32,844 in England on the official Index of Multiple Deprivation (rank 1 is the most deprived).
